Brain abscess caused by Mycobacterium avium complex in an adolescent with an inborn error of immunity
Manuel Feuerstein1, Luciana Santelli1, Carolina Garrigue1
1Hospital General de Niños Ricardo Gutiérrez, Autonomous City of Buenos Aires, Argentina.
Abstract:
Mycobacterium avium complex (MAC) infections of the central nervous system are rare and represent a diagnostic challenge, especially in immunocompromised patients. Comprehensive management requires early diagnosis, prolonged antimicrobial treatment, and, in some cases, neurosurgical interventions. We present the case of a 16-year-old patient with an inborn error of immunity caused by a variant in the NFKB1A gene, who consulted for paresis of the left upper limb. A diagnosis of brain abscess was made using central nervous system (CNS) imaging, and the etiological agent was confirmed by neurosurgical biopsy culture after an unfavorable clinical course with initial empirical treatment. The patient was treated with rifampicin, ethambutol, levofloxacin, linezolid, clarithromycin, and high-dose dexamethasone, achieving significant clinical and radiological improvement after prolonged treatment.
